Cluster chemistry. Part 99; An unusual hydrocarbon-cluster bonding mode in Ru3 (μ3-2 η1, 2η3 - C14H17Me) (μ-CO) (CO)7, obtained from Ru3 (CO)12 and 1,5,9 - Trimethylcyclododeca - 1,5,9-triene

A reaction between Ru3(CO)12 and 1,5,9-trimethylcyclododeca-1,5,9-trine has given the orange-red complex Ru3(μ3-2η1, 2η3-C14H17Me)(μ-CO)(CO)7, fully characterized by a single-crystal X-ray study. The hydrocarbon is attached to an irregular closed Ru3 cluster by two Ru-C σ-bonds and two η-allylic systems, the latter involving exocyclic CH2 and CH groups. The preparation of Ru3 (μ-H) (μ3-C12H15) (μ-dppm) (CO)7 is also reported. 10 refs., 2 tabs., 1 fig., ills
